17 July 2012
On a sad note, our local aviation law community lost a good guy today. Don Maciejewski passed away early this afternoon after suffering a severe acute illness on Saturday. Don was one of 33 board certified aviation law attorneys (out of more than 93000 Florida attorneys) and was a partner at Zisser, Robison, Brown, Nowlis & Maciejewski, P.A. He served as a helicopter pilot in the U.S. Army and was a Major in the U.S. Army Reserve. He was a commercially rated helicopter pilot and flew UH1, OH58 and Hughes 300 aircraft.
